The Impact of Lighting on Productivity

Adequate lighting is crucial for maintaining optimal workplace productivity. Studies have shown that insufficient or poorly designed lighting can lead to eye strain, headaches, and fatigue, ultimately hindering employee performance. Ceiling fan lights offer a versatile solution by providing both ambient and task lighting. The adjustable brightness settings allow employees to customize the lighting intensity to suit their individual needs and preferences, minimizing eye strain and promoting focus. Moreover, the strategic placement of ceiling fan lights ensures even illumination throughout the workspace, eliminating dark spots and promoting a comfortable and productive work environment.

The Role of Air Circulation in Productivity

Air circulation plays a vital role in maintaining a comfortable and productive work environment. Poor ventilation can lead to stagnant air, increased humidity, and a buildup of pollutants, creating an uncomfortable and unhealthy atmosphere. Ceiling fan lights address this issue by providing efficient air circulation. The rotating blades create a gentle breeze that helps to circulate fresh air, reducing humidity and improving air quality. This enhanced ventilation promotes alertness and reduces drowsiness, leading to improved concentration and productivity.
